Several powerful forces are driving interest in van rentals for experiential travel. Rising costs of traditional accommodation are shifting preferences toward flexible, cost-effective ways to explore. Economic pressures push travelers toward self-reliant trips where renting a van offers both budget control and freedom.

Success depends on planning: map routes in advance, study local regulations, and pack for variable conditions. Yet, for those willing to embrace change, these journeys create lasting memories—shared photos, personal growth, and authentic encounters that digital feeds can’t replicate.
Digital trends also play a key role. Mobile-first content fuels curiosity about off-grid destinations, with users searching for inspiration, safety tips, and logistics. Social media features authentic van life content—photography, vlogs, and firsthand stories—that resonate with audiences craving adventure without the rigidity of guided tours.
The beauty lies in the customizable experience—no two journeys are exactly alike.
These trips encourage deeper engagement—discovering local markets, hidden viewpoints, and quiet gatherings that define the soul of a place, not just its scenic beauty.
Consider itineraries that blend spontaneity with structure: base yourself in a charming small town, retreat to mountain passes by day, and gather under open skies at night. Van rentals often come with essentials like GPS, first-aid kits, and ideal resting spaces—tools that support safety and comfort without sacrificing spontaneity.
The appeal of go-off-the-beaten-path van travel comes with realistic considerations. Time management, unpredictable weather, and remote logistics require preparation. While hidden gems offer beauty and peace, travelers may miss predictable infrastructure or crowded amenities.
